A woman from Carrboro wins $1 million recently in Cash lottery game

A Carrboro woman took a chance on a $10 scratch-off ticket and won a $1 million prize. Susana Brache bought her lucky 50X The Cash ticket from the Short Stop on West Main Street in Carrboro.

Brache arrived at lottery headquarters Monday and chose to receive the lump sum of $600,000. After required state and federal taxes, she took home $427,503.

The 50X The Cash game debuted in February with six top prizes of $1 million. Since Brache won the last top prize, the lottery will begin the process of ending the game.
